Échantillons
Des spécimens sont disponibles pour une grande variété de procédures de test organiques et inorganiques. Les échantillons organiques peuvent être utilisés pour la dissection ou l’étude de spécimens entiers, vivants ou conservés, avec des exemples pratiques en biologie cellulaire ou dans l’analyse de la structure interne d’organes et de systèmes multicellulaires complexes. Les spécimens de roche permettent l’étude des textures, des tailles de grains et d’autres caractéristiques influencées par la pression, la température et d’autres forces naturelles, offrant un aperçu de l’histoire géologique de la Terre.
